Skeletal muscle is a type of striated muscle, attached to the skeleton. Basic Principles of Skeletal Muscles The human body has some 600 skeletal muscles, but this text will discuss only some of the most significant of these. First, let us consider certain basic principles of muscle contraction. When a muscle contracts, one bone remains fairly stationary, and the other one moves. Jones & Smith 1993). Psychology really got going as a discipline when two men decided to take the principles of scientific research and apply them to the study of human behavior. 3 Reflex Arc Components of a Reflex Arc A. Receptor - reacts to a stimulus B. Afferent pathway (sensory neuron) - conducts impulses to the CNS C. Interneuron - consists of one or more synapses in the CNS (most are in the spine) D. Efferent pathway (motor neuron) conducts impulses from CNS to effector. Osteopenia has two causes. This is the smallest unit of skeletal muscle that can contract. Sliding filament theory is the mechanism by which muscles are thought to contract at a cellular level. A good understanding of skeletal muscle structure is useful when learning how sliding filament theory works. What is sliding filament theory? At a very basic level, each muscle fibre is made up of smaller fibres called myofibrils. [Diagram].
